Our Podcast is called "Mark's Ending, Take It or Leave It". That is intended to raise an eyebrow, but I want to explain it this way. If you end your reading at verse 8 of Mark 16, you're OK. The other 3 Gospels, harmonized, complete the picture. Nothing is lost by losing or keeping that section of Mark. In other words, don't throw the baby out with the bathwater. The ending in Mark is not wrong, but I think you'll agree with me, it's not written by Mark. There's a lot we can learn from this section.
